"Grandfathers" is an English equivalent of the Italian word nonni. The masculine plural noun also translates into English as "grandparents" in terms of either a group of only grandfathers or of mixed grandmothers and grandfathers. The pronunciation will be "NON-nee" in Italian.

Is 'nonni' 'grandmother' when translated from Italian to English?

Nonni is the plural meaning grandparents. grandmother is "nonna" and grandfather is "nonno"

Is 'nonni' the Italian equivalent of the English word 'Grandma'?

No, nonni is not the Italian equivalent of the English word 'Grandma."Specifically, the masculine noun nonni means "grandfathers, grandfathers and grandmothers, grandparents" and is pronounced "NOHN-nee." The feminine noun nonna means "grandmother" and is pronounced "NOHN-nah." But particularly in Sicily and southern Italy, the word nonna becomes nonie, which is pronounced "NOH-nee."
